  • the invention relates to a household appliance device according to the preamble of claim 1 and a method for assembling a household appliance device according to the preamble of claim 14.
  • a household appliance device which has a device body with two recesses.
  • a first recess of the recesses has a first longitudinal extension and a second recess of the recesses has a second longitudinal extension.
  • a substantially pin-shaped wall spacer unit is arranged in a first assembled state partially in the first recess and thereby defines a first minimum distance of the device body to a wall. In a second assembled state, the wall spacer unit is partially disposed in the second recess and thereby defines a second minimum distance of the device body to the wall.
  • the invention relates to a household appliance device, in particular a domestic refrigeration device, with at least one device body, which has at least one recess, and with at least one wall spacer unit which is at least partially disposed in the recess and provided in at least a first mounted state, in the first mount state to set at least a first minimum distance of the device body to a wall.
  • the wall spacer unit in particular in cooperation with the device body, at least in a second mounted state at least partially disposed in the recess and is intended to set in the second mounted state, at least a second minimum distance of the device body to the wall.

  • Fig. 1 shows a household appliance 42, which is designed as a household refrigerator, in an operating condition.
  • the household appliance 42 is designed as a cooling device.
  • the household appliance 42 could be designed as a freezer and / or as a fridge-freezer combination device.
  • the household appliance 42 has a household appliance device 10.
  • the household appliance device 10 is designed as a household refrigeration device.
  • the household appliance device 10 has a device body 12.
  • the device body 12 partially defines a device compartment (not shown).
  • the equipment compartment is formed in the present embodiment as a cold room.
  • the equipment room is designed as a refrigerator. Alternatively, the equipment room could be designed as a freezer compartment.
  • the household refrigeration appliance 10 has a door 44.
  • the appliance door 44 is pivotally mounted relative to the appliance body 12. In the operating state, the appliance door 44 closes the cold room.
  • the device body 12 has an opening 38 (see. Fig. 2 ).
  • the opening 38 is accessible from a rear of the device.
  • the opening 38 is formed as a machine room.
  • the device body 12 has two recesses 14. Of multiply existing objects, only one is provided with a reference numeral in the figures. In an installed position, the recesses 14 are arranged on opposite edge regions of the device body 12 in a horizontal direction. In the following, only one of the recesses 14 will be described.
  • the device body 12 has a Schoumtraverse 46.
  • the Schumtraverse 46 is disposed in an installed position, in particular directly, above the opening 38.
  • the recess 14 could be arranged in a wall of the device body 12, such as a rear wall of the device body 12.
  • the recess 14 is arranged in the present embodiment in the Schwarzumtraverse 46.
  • the household appliance device 10 has a wall spacer unit 16 (cf. Fig. 2 to 8 ).
  • the wall spacer unit 16 In a first assembled state, the wall spacer unit 16 is partially disposed in the recess 14 (see FIG. Fig. 2 . 3 . 5 and 7 ).
  • the wall spacer unit 16 sets in the first mounted state, a first minimum distance 18 of the device body 12 to a wall 20 fixed. In the present embodiment, the first minimum distance 18 is substantially 25 mm.
  • the wall 20 is part of the system 48.
  • the home appliance device 10 is part of a system 48.
  • the wall spacer unit 16 has a first rotational position in the first mounted state. In the first assembled state, the wall spacer unit 16 is partially disposed in the first rotational position in the recess 14.
  • the wall spacer unit 16 In a second assembled state, the wall spacer unit 16 is partially disposed in the recess 14 (see FIG. Fig. 4 . 6 and 8th ). The wall spacer unit 16 sets in the second mounted state a second minimum distance 22 of the device body 12 to the wall 20 fixed.
  • the wall spacer unit 16 has, in the second mounted state, a second rotational position that is different from the first rotational position. In the second assembled state, the wall spacer unit 16 is partially disposed in the second rotational position in the recess 14. In the present embodiment, the second minimum distance 22 is substantially 15 mm.
  • the wall spacer unit 16 can be transferred from the first rotary position to the second rotary position, in particular by a rotation of the wall spacer unit 16 through an angle of substantially 180 °.
  • the wall spacer unit 16 can be converted from the second rotational position into the first rotational position by a rotation about the axis of rotation 24 oriented perpendicular to the recess 14, in particular by a rotation of the wall spacer unit 16 through an angle of substantially 180 °.
  • the household appliance device 10 has a first latching element 26 (cf. Fig. 8 ). In the first assembled state, the first latching element 26 latches the wall spacer unit 16 on the device body 12. In the present exemplary embodiment, the first latching element 26 is integrally connected to the wall spacer unit 16.
  • the household appliance device 10 has a second latching element 28 (cf. Fig. 3 to 5 and 7 ).
  • the second locking element 28 locks in the second mounted state, the wall spacer unit 16 on the device body 12.
  • the second locking element 28 is integrally connected to the wall spacer unit 16.
  • the first latching element 26 and the second latching element 28 are, in particular in an installed position and advantageous with respect to a horizontal direction, on opposite one another Side of the wall spacer unit 16 is arranged. With regard to an insertion direction 30 of the wall spacer unit 16 into the recess 14, the first latching element 26 and the second latching element 28 are arranged offset to one another.
  • the household appliance device 10 has a packaging aid 32 (cf. Fig. 2 to 8 ).
  • the packaging aid 32 substantially prevents damage to the wall spacer unit 16, such as breaking the wall spacer unit 16 and / or breaking off at least a portion of the wall spacer unit 16.
  • the packaging aid 32 substantially prevents damage to a package during a packaging process, such as tearing of the package and / or tearing of the package.
  • the packing aid 32 has a sliding ramp 34.
  • the slide ramp 34 provides a sliding surface 36 for packaging in the packaging process. In the packaging process, the package slides over the sliding surface 36, which in particular prevents damage to the wall spacer unit 16 and the package.
  • the packaging aid 32 is integrally connected to the wall spacer unit 16.
  • the packaging aid 32 in particular the sliding ramp 34, is arranged in a vicinity of the device body 12.
  • the packaging aid 32, in particular the sliding ramp 34 is arranged in the first mounted state with respect to a vertical direction partially above the recess 14.
  • the packaging aid 32 in particular the sliding ramp 34
  • the packaging aid 32 in particular the sliding ramp 34, is arranged in the second mounted state with respect to a vertical direction partially below the recess 14.
  • the wall spacer unit 16 protrudes partially into the opening 38 of the device body 12 in the second mounted state.
  • the wall spacer unit 16 has a cable guide unit 40 (cf. Fig. 2 to 8 ). When viewed in a side view of the wall spacer unit 16, the cable guide unit 40 has a substantially crescent shape.
  • the cable management unit 40 is provided for guiding a cable (not shown).
  • the first minimum distance 18 of the appliance body 12 to the wall 20 is determined.
  • the wall spacer unit 16 is released counter to the insertion direction 30 from the recess 14, in particular by releasing a locking connection caused by the first latching element 26.
  • the wall spacer unit 16 By rotation of the wall spacer unit 16 about the axis of rotation 24, the wall spacer unit 16 is transferred from the first rotational position to the second rotational position.
  • the wall spacer unit 16 is inserted in the insertion direction 40 in the recess.
  • the wall spacer unit 16 is latched by means of the second latching element 28 on the device body 12.
  • the second minimum distance 22 of the device body 12 In the second assembled state of the wall spacer unit 16 in the recess 14, the second minimum distance 22 of the device body 12 is fixed to the wall 20.
  • the household appliance 42 is factory delivered in the first assembled state of the wall spacer unit 16 in the recess 14.
